(->>pp tag thing)Pretty print in ->> threading macro. Optionally tag the thing with :tag to pp a hash map of {tag thing}
Pretty print in `->>` threading macro. Optionally tag the thing with `:tag` to pp a hash map of `{tag thing}`
(->pp thing tag)Pretty print in -> threading macro. Optionally tag the thing with :tag to pp a hash map of {tag thing}
Pretty print in `->` threading macro. Optionally tag the thing with `:tag` to pp a hash map of `{tag thing}`
(classpath->vec)Return class path as vector of absolute paths
Return class path as vector of absolute paths
(clear-aliases)(clear-aliases an-ns)Reset aliases for given ns or current one if no args given
Reset aliases for given ns or current one if no args given
(describe-ns an-ns & {:keys [s docs?]})Describes given namespace by listing public symbols, optionally filters down via :s <search>
and can optionally add the doc string with :docs? true
Describes given namespace by listing **public** symbols, optionally filters down via `:s <search>` and can optionally add the doc string with `:docs?` true
(doc thing)(list-ns)(list-ns root)Return list of symbols of namespaces found in a dir. Default: ./src
Return list of symbols of namespaces found in a dir. Default: `./src`
(pp thing)Like ppn, but returns passed in data. Useful for debugging threaded calls
Like `ppn`, but returns passed in data. Useful for debugging threaded calls
(refresh)Refresh changed namespaces, only if its safe
Refresh changed namespaces, only if its safe
(refresh-all)Refresh everything, only if its safe
Refresh everything, only if its safe
(safe-to-refresh?)Check if refresh is safe, by verifying that application system is not running
Check if refresh is safe, by verifying that application system is not running
(t)(t ns-list)Run tests via kaocha - either all or a list of vars.
note
It will not refresh any code - use t! for that
Run tests via kaocha - either all or a list of vars. > [!NOTE] > It will not refresh any code - use `t!` for that
(t!)(t! & ns-list)Run tests via kaocha, but refresh first - runs all tests or a list (or one) of ns vars.
![NOTE] Refresh happens only if it's safe to do so e.g. dev system is not running
Run tests via kaocha, but refresh first - runs all tests or a list (or one) of ns vars. > ![NOTE] > Refresh happens only if it's safe to do so e.g. dev system is not running
(tap-> thing)(tap-> thing tag)Like tap> but returns input, and is designed for threading macros. Optionally tag the thing with :tag to tap a hash map of {tag thing}
Like `tap>` but returns input, and is designed for threading macros. Optionally tag the thing with `:tag` to tap a hash map of `{tag thing}`
(tap->> thing)(tap->> tag thing)Like tap> but returns input, and is designed for threading macros. Optionally tag the thing with :tag to tap a hash map of {tag thing}
Like `tap>` but returns input, and is designed for threading macros. Optionally tag the thing with `:tag` to tap a hash map of `{tag thing}`
(tests pattern)Find test namespace vars by a regex
Find test namespace vars by a regex
